162059288256 is an even composite number. It is composed of five dist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of three hundred seventy-eight divisors.

Prime factorization of 162059288256:

26 × 32 × 192 × 312 × 811

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 19 × 19 × 31 × 31 × 811)

  • 162,059,288,256 seconds is equal to 5,152 years, 51 weeks, 1 day, 4 hours, 57 minutes, 36 seconds.
  • To count from 1 to 162,059,288,256 would take you about ten thousand, three hundred five years!

    This is a very rough estimate, based on a speaking rate of half a second every third order of magnitude. If you speak quickly, you could probably say any randomly-chosen number between one and a thousand in around half a second. Very big numbers obviously take longer to say, so we add half a second for every extra x1000. (We do not count involuntary pauses, bathroom breaks or the necessity of sleep in our calculation!)

  • A cube with a volume of 162059288256 cubic inches would be around 454.3 feet tall.
